The Verification Bottleneck: What We Actually Measured

Every UKGC-licensed site must verify identity before processing withdrawals above certain thresholds. That’s non-negotiable. But the speed of that verification depends entirely on whether the operator uses automated document scanning, manual review teams, or some hybrid system. We tested each casino by uploading a passport photo, a utility bill, and in some cases a proof of deposit method.

Sky Vegas processed our documents in under 90 minutes. That’s reliable engineering , their system uses optical character recognition (OCR) to extract data from the passport, cross-references it against the utility bill address, and flags only mismatches for human review. Most sites took between 4 and 12 hours. A couple dragged past 24 hours, which in 2026 is frankly unacceptable.

Why RNG Certification Matters More Than You Think

Live dealer blackjack isn’t a random number generator game , it uses real cards, real shuffles, real cameras. But the software that manages the bet settlement, the shoe tracking, and the payout calculation absolutely relies on certified RNG for ancillary features like side bets and insurance. Every casino we tested uses either eCOGRA (ecogra.org) or iTech Labs (itechlabs.com) certification for their digital components.

Wagering Requirements: The Hidden Tax on Your Winnings

Every welcome bonus comes with strings attached. We analysed the terms for each site’s offer and found a wide range of wagering multipliers. PlayOJO leads the pack with zero wagering on their 50 free spins , a genuine USP. MrQ also offers no wagering on their 100 free spins, which is rare in the UK market. Most other sites sit between 10x and 40x wagering on either the bonus amount or the free spin winnings.

Here is the trap: some operators apply wagering to both the deposit and the bonus. Others only apply it to the bonus. Read the T&Cs carefully. For example, 888 Casino’s welcome offer requires 10x wagering on the bonus amount, with a maximum win cap of £100. That means even if you hit a big win with the bonus funds, you can only withdraw £100. The rest disappears. That isn’t a unreliable offers , it is clearly stated in their terms , but it is easy to miss when you are excited about the offer.

If you want to avoid this complexity entirely, stick with wager-free offers from MrQ, PlayOJO, or Sky Vegas. The trade-off is that the free spin values are lower (typically 10p per spin), but the winnings are yours to keep with no further playthrough required.

Banking Options: What the Backend Supports

All ten sites accept debit cards (Visa and Mastercard) as standard. E-wallet support varies. PayPal is widely accepted, but some operators exclude it from bonus eligibility. For example, 888 Casino explicitly excludes PayPal deposits from their welcome offer. The reason is technical: PayPal transactions cost the operator more in processing fees than debit card payments. From a backend perspective, it makes sense to restrict the bonus to lower-cost payment methods. From a player perspective, it’s annoying.

We recommend using an e-wallet for withdrawals regardless of the bonus terms. E-wallet payouts cleared in under 24 hours at every site we tested. Card withdrawals took 1 to 3 business days, which is standard for the UK market. If speed matters to you, set up a PayPal or Skrill account before you deposit.

>What documents do I need to verify my account for live dealer blackjack uk?

Most UKGC-licensed casinos require a valid passport or driving licence for identity verification, plus a recent utility bill or bank statement for address proof. Some sites also ask for a photo of the debit card used for deposit (with the middle digits covered). The process usually takes between 1 and 24 hours depending on the operator’s automation level.

>What happens if I lose my internet connection during a live hand?

Most live dealer software will automatically complete the current hand using the dealer’s predetermined actions. Your bet is settled based on the outcome. If the connection drops before you make a decision (e.g., split or stand), the system may default to “stand” or “hit” depending on the casino’s rules. Check the specific game’s help section for details.
